Quite truthfully, I can say I've never given up hope of signing Josh Malone.

If a team has one great receiver, he can be double-teamed. If you've got two great receivers and a mobile QB, you can force the defense into situations they are not able to adequately defend.

I think North may be the only receiver on our roster that could demand a double team in a couple of years. Not that we don't have others who could be pretty good, but I don't see other teams feeling a need to double cover them. I don't see any guys committed in the 2014 class that would demand a double team. I think Malone could be that other guy.
